Nutrien (TSX:NTR) took the stage at the Soil Health Conference in Calgary this week, drawing extra attention from investors and the broader agriculture sector. Company presentations at events like these can sometimes provide fresh insights into strategy or upcoming innovations, even if all the details aren't immediately disclosed. Right now, many are wondering if something meaningful was hinted at, or if this is just another momentary spotlight for the stock.

It has been an interesting stretch for Nutrien, with modest price changes over the past month but a notable rally since the start of the year. Over the past year, investors have seen the stock climb 30%, easily outpacing much of the market. However, its longer-term trajectory has been bumpier. The combination of recent conference remarks and year-to-date performance is leading some to wonder if momentum is finally turning after a sluggish few quarters.

So, after all this movement, is Nutrien trading at a bargain, or is the market already anticipating the next wave of growth?

Most Popular Narrative: 8.5% Undervalued

The most widely followed narrative sees Nutrien as undervalued by nearly 9%, pointing to a disconnect between the current share price and expectations for future growth and market stability.

The drive to maximize yields per acre due to climate change, shrinking arable land, and erratic weather is boosting fertilizer adoption and incentivizing precision agriculture. Nutrien's investments in automation, precision agriculture, and efficiency position it to capture higher-margin, premium sales and expand net margins over time.
